Senior Designer Wanted for Luxury Fashion and Homewares Brand

Established in 1972, BONZ is a family-run fashion and homewares brand that specialises in creating elevated and opulent designs from rare and high-quality locally sourced materials. The products are all made at their Invercargill factory, and sold in their retail locations, selected global luxury retailers, and e-commerce store.

THE ROLE

BONZ is looking for a Senior Designer to join their team that can help modernise and consolidate their apparel collections – leather and knitwear. You will work closely with their CEO and current design team and be accountable for the overall design, ensuring all styles are on point and successful in the market. You will also be working directly with the Senior Pattern Maker, signing off on the fit of all garments, so a hands-on technical background is a must.

The factory is based in Invercargill, and their head office is in Queenstown. For this role, BONZ is open to a remote working situation that could include trips to the factory monthly.
